Medical - Medical: Cardiology / Physical examination
Spanish term or phrase: AQRS = +10°PF; Ap = +60ºPF; At = +50ºPF
This is part of the ECG results included in a physical examination report (Resting ECG section).

AQRS is the English acronym, which is also used in Spanish. The problem is PF...what does it stand for? Could it refer to "plano frontal", hence "frontal plane" in an ECG?
